Coinbase Global announced at the cryptocurrency summit that it will launch perpetual futures compliant with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) regulations in the United States. U.S. traders will thus be able to trade related cryptocurrency trading products in the market.
The new product is designed with the offshore perpetual futures 'no expiration date' feature, anchored through funding rates and spot prices, and operates in accordance with U.S. margin and clearing regulations.
Initially supporting BTC and ETH trading pairs, it offers the same functionality as global mainstream perpetual contracts, including a funding rate mechanism that settles every 8 hours, stop-loss and take-profit risk management tools, and is deeply integrated with Coinbase's spot trading, providing better liquidity.
Previously, due to regulatory restrictions, U.S. investors had limited choices in cryptocurrency derivatives trading, either using domestically limited products or risking compliance by using offshore exchange services.
